Actions
action #73294
opencoordination #102906: [saga][epic] Increased stability of tests with less "known failures", known incompletes handled automatically within openQA
coordination #102909: [epic] Prevent more incompletes already within os-autoinst or openQA
auto_review:"isotovideo died: needles_dir not found" should be 'tests died' or something similar obvious to test maintainers that they need to act
Status:
Workable
Priority:
Low
Assignee:
-
Category:
Feature requests
Target version:
QA (public, currently private due to #173521) - future
Start date:
2020-10-13
Due date:
% Done:
0%
Estimated time:
Description
Observation¶
https://openqa.opensuse.org/tests/1429916 shows
Reason: isotovideo died: needles_dir not found: /var/lib/openqa/share/tests/microos/var/lib/openqa/share/tests/microos/products/microos/needles (check vars.json?) at /usr/lib/os-autoinst/needle.pm line 330.
Likely error from autoinst-log.txt:
[0mneedles_dir not found: /var/lib/openqa/share/tests/microos/var/lib/openqa/share/tests/microos/products/microos/needles (check vars.json?) at /usr/lib/os-autoinst/needle.pm line 330.
Acceptance criteria¶
- AC1: It is obvious to test maintainers that they need to act
Suggestions¶
- Make sure the message is returned in a way that it is obvious to test maintainers that they need to act, e.g. return the reason "tests died" which we already ignore in https://github.com/os-autoinst/scripts/blob/master/openqa-monitor-incompletes#L6 but maybe we can come up with something even better
Actions